信息提醒的方法、装置及系统的制作方法

文档序号:7974409阅读:136来源:国知局
专利名称:信息提醒的方法、装置及系统的制作方法
技术领域
本发明涉及通讯技术领域,尤其涉及一种信息提醒的方法、装置及系统。
背景技术
随着社会的不断发展,每个人需要接收的信息越来越多。目前,用户可以在一个终端设备上设置信息提醒,用于提醒所述用户有新的信息发送到所述用户终端上,以使得所述用户在所述用户终端上可以及时获取信息,但是当所述用户拥有多个终端设备时,在信息到来时,用户有可能因为正在使用未设置信息提醒的终端设备而未接收到提醒信息,使得用户没有能够及时地获取信息,使得信息提醒失去时效性。

发明内容
本发明的实施例提供一种信息提醒的方法、装置及系统,实现了拥有多个终端设备的用户,在设置信息提醒后能够及时准确地接收到提醒信息。为达到上述目的,本发明的实施例采用如下技术方案一种信息提醒的方法,包括接收终端设备发送的状态信息,并根据所述状态信息携带的用户标识将所述状态信息保存到与所述用户标识对应的状态信息集合中;在需要发送提醒信息时,根据所述提醒信息携带的用户标识获取与所述用户标识对应的状态信息集合,所述状态信息集合包括同一个用户标识对应的多个终端设备的状态 fn息;根据所述状态信息集合选取目的终端设备,将所述提醒信息发送给所述目的终端设备。一种信息提醒的装置,包括接收保存模块,用于接收终端设备发送的状态信息,并根据所述状态信息携带的用户标识将所述状态信息保存到与所述用户标识对应的状态信息集合中;获取模块,用于在需要发送提醒信息时,根据所述提醒信息携带的用户标识获取与所述用户标识对应的所述接收保存模块保存的状态信息集合,所述状态信息集合包括同一个用户标识对应的多个终端设备的状态信息;选取发送模块,用于根据所述获取模块获取的所述状态信息集合选取目的终端设备,将所述提醒信息发送给所述目的终端设备。一种信息提醒的系统,包括终端状态检测模块,用于接收终端设备发送的状态信息,并根据所述状态信息携带的用户标识将所述状态信息保存到与所述用户标识对应的状态信息集合中;云端服务模块,用于在需要发送提醒信息时,根据所述提醒信息携带的用户标识获取与所述用户标识对应的状态信息集合,所述状态信息集合包括同一个用户标识对应的多个终端设备的状态信息,根据所述状态信息集合选取目的终端设备,将所述提醒信息发送给所述目的终端设备;选择设备发送信息模块,用于将所述提醒信息发送给所述目的终端设备。本发明实施例提供的信息提醒的方法、装置及系统,通过实时获取终端设备的状态信息,并根据所述状态信息选取目的终端设备发送提醒信息,以使得提醒信息可以准确及时地发送到用户正在使用或携带的终端设备中,实现了拥有多个终端设备的用户,在设置信息提醒后能够及时准确地接收到提醒信息。


为了更清楚地说明本发明实施例或现有技术中的技术方案,下面将对实施例或现有技术描述中所需要使用的附图作简单地介绍,显而易见地,下面描述中的附图仅仅是本发明的一些实施例,对于本领域普通技术人员来讲,在不付出创造性劳动的前提下,还可以根据这些附图获得其他的附图。图1为本发明实施例1中的一种信息提醒的方法流程图;图2为本发明实施例2中的一种信息提醒的方法流程图;图3为本发明实施例3中的一种信息提醒的装置的组成框图;图4为本发明实施例3中的另一种信息提醒的装置的组成框图;图5为本发明实施例3中的另一种信息提醒的装置的组成框图;图6为本发明实施例3中的一种信息提醒的系统的组成框图。
具体实施例方式下面将结合本发明实施例中的附图,对本发明实施例中的技术方案进行清楚、完整地描述,显然,所描述的实施例仅仅是本发明一部分实施例,而不是全部的实施例。基于本发明中的实施例,本领域普通技术人员在没有作出创造性劳动前提下所获得的所有其他实施例,都属于本发明保护的范围。实施例1本发明实施例提供了一种信息提醒的方法,如图1所示,该方法包括101、接收终端设备发送的状态信息,并根据所述状态信息携带的用户标识将所述状态信息保存到与所述用户标识对应的状态信息集合中。102、在需要发送提醒信息时,根据所述提醒信息携带的用户标识获取与所述用户标识对应的状态信息集合,所述状态信息集合包括同一个用户标识对应的多个终端设备的状态信息。103、根据所述状态信息集合选取目的终端设备,将所述提醒信息发送给所述目的终端设备。本发明实施例提供的信息提醒的方法,通过实时获取终端设备的状态信息,并根据所述状态信息选取目的终端设备发送提醒信息,以使得提醒信息可以准确及时地发送到用户正在使用或携带的终端设备中,实现了拥有多个终端设备的用户,在设置信息提醒后能够及时准确地接收到提醒信息。实施例2本发明实施例提供了一种信息提醒的方法,以终端设备为PC (PersonalComputer,个人计算机),平板电脑(Wad)及酷派手机(coolPAD)为例进行描述,如图2所示,该方法包括201、接收PC、iPad及coolPAD发送的状态信息,并根据所述状态信息携带的用户标识将所述状态信息保存到与所述用户标识对应的状态信息集合中。其中,所述状态信息包括iPad及coolPAD的重力传感器数据,PC、iPad及coolPAD 的最近使用时间以及PC、iPad及coolPAD预先设置的优先级,接收所述状态信息可以通过无线网络(如WIFI、3G或4G等)或有线网络(如IP网络等)实现,本发明实施例对此不进行限制。其中,所述用户标识可以为用户的身份证号码或由业务服务器为用户预设值的 ID (identity,标识号),以使得所述PC、iPad及coolPAD的状态信息可以根据所述用户标识存储在一起,作为一个状态信息集合统一管理,其中,一个状态信息集合用于存储对应于同一个用户的所述PC、iPad及coolPAD的状态信息,本发明实施例对此不进行限制。202、在需要发送提醒信息时,根据所述提醒信息携带的用户标识获取与所述用户标识对应的所述PC、iPad及coolPAD的状态信息集合,所述状态信息集合包括同一个用户标识对应的所述PC、iPad及coolPAD的状态信息。其中,所述提醒信息可以为所述PC、iPad及cooIPAD能够显示的文字、图片或者可以播放的响铃或者音乐等,用于告知用户有新的信息到来,以使得用户获取所述新的信息, 本发明实施例对此不进行限制。203、根据所述PC、iPad及coolPAD的状态信息集合,生成分别对应于所述PC、Wad 及coolPAD的优先级值。其中,所述根据根据所述PC、iPad及coolPAD的状态信息集合选取目的终端设备, 将所述提醒信息发送给所述目的终端设备可以通过以下方法实现,具体为优先级计算公式为优先级=终端设备预设置的优先级+重力传感器优先级+最近使用时间优先级+ 使用次数优先级。其中,终端设备预设置的优先级一般由用户进行设置,预先设置的关系为PC预设置的优先级小于iPad预设置的优先级,iPad预设置的优先级小于coolPAD 预设置的优先级。其中,重力传感器优先级关系为iPad优先级小于coolPAD优先级。其中,终端设备最近使用时间优先级,根据用户是否正在访问该终端,计算公式为终端设备最近使用时间优先级=100除以(当前使用时间-上次使用时间)。其中,使用次数由所述最近使用时间统计得到。根据上面的计算公式以及规则以及所述状态信息生成对应的优先级值,由三个终端设备的终端设备预设置优先级生成的第一优先级值分别为PC = LiPad = 2,coolPAD = 3 ;由重力传感器优先级生成的第二优先级值分别为PC = 0,iPad = 1,coolPAD = 2 ;由终端设备最近使用时间优先级生成的第三优先级值分别为coolPAD = 6,PC = 2,iPad = 0 ; 访由问次数优先级生成的第四优先级值分别为coolPAD = 5,PC = 2,iPad = 0。经过相加计算后得到的三个终端的优先级对应的第五优先级值分别为
PC = 5,iPad = 3,coolPAD = 16。204、根据所述对应于所述PC、iPad及coolPAD的优先级值,选取coolPAD为目的终端设备。其中,需要说明的是,所述终端设备优先级值越大,说明用户正在使用所述终端设备的可能性越高。205、将所述提醒信息发送给coolPAD。其中,需要说明的是,所述将所述提醒信息发送给用户终端可以通过无线网络 (如WIFI、3G或4G等)或有线网络(如hternet等)实现,本发明实施例对此不进行限制。本发明实施例提供的信息提醒的方法,通过实时获取终端设备的状态信息,并根据所述状态信息生成对应于同一个用户的多个终端设备的优先级值,并选取优先级值最大的终端设备作为目的终端设备发送提醒信息,以使得提醒信息可以准确及时地发送到用户正在使用或携带的终端设备中,实现了拥有多个终端设备的用户,在设置信息提醒后能够及时准确地接收到提醒信息。实施例3本发明实施例提供了一种信息提醒的装置,如图3所示,该装置包括接收保存模块31、获取模块32、选取发送模块33。接收保存模块31,用于接收终端设备发送的状态信息,并根据所述状态信息携带的用户标识将所述状态信息保存到与所述用户标识对应的状态信息集合中。获取模块32,用于在需要发送提醒信息时,根据所述提醒信息携带的用户标识获取与所述用户标识对应的所述接收保存模块31保存的状态信息集合,所述状态信息集合包括同一个用户标识对应的多个终端设备的状态信息。选取发送模块33,用于根据所述获取模块32获取的所述状态信息集合选取目的终端设备,将所述提醒信息发送给所述目的终端设备。进一步的,如图4所示,所述选取发送模块33包括生成单元331、选取单元332、 发送单元333。生成单元331,用于根据所述状态信息集合,生成分别对应于所述多个终端设备的优先级值。选取单元332,用于根据所述生成单元331生成的所述对应于所述多个终端设备的优先级值,选取目的终端设备,所述目的用户终端为优先级值最大的用户终端。发送单元333,用于将所述提醒信息发送给所述选取单元332选取的所述目的终端设备。进一步的,如图5所示,所述生成单元331包括第一生成子单元3311,用于根据所述多个终端设备的状态信息集合,生成分别对应于所述多个终端设备的终端设备访问次数。第二生成子单元3312,用于根据所述状态信息及所述终端设备访问次数,生成分别对应于所述多个终端设备的优先级值。本发明提供了一种信息提醒的系统,如图6所示,包括终端状态检测模块41、云端服务模块42、选择设备发送信息模块43。
终端状态检测模块41,用于接收终端设备发送的状态信息,并根据所述状态信息携带的用户标识将所述状态信息保存到与所述用户标识对应的状态信息集合中。云端服务模块42,用于在需要发送提醒信息时,根据所述提醒信息携带的用户标识获取与所述用户标识对应的状态信息集合,所述状态信息集合包括同一个用户标识对应的多个终端设备的状态信息,根据所述状态信息集合选取目的终端设备,将所述提醒信息发送给所述目的终端设备。选择设备发送信息模块43,用于将所述提醒信息发送给所述目的终端设备。本发明实施例提供的信息提醒的装置及系统,通过实时获取终端设备的状态信息,并根据所述状态信息生成对应于同一个用户的多个终端设备的优先级值,并选取优先级值最大的终端设备作为目的终端设备发送提醒信息,以使得提醒信息可以准确及时地发送到用户正在使用或携带的终端设备中,实现了拥有多个终端设备的用户,在设置信息提醒后能够及时准确地接收到提醒信息。通过以上的实施方式的描述,所属领域的技术人员可以清楚地了解到本发明可借助软件加必需的通用硬件的方式来实现,当然也可以通过硬件,但很多情况下前者是更佳的实施方式。基于这样的理解,本发明的技术方案本质上或者说对现有技术做出贡献的部分可以以软件产品的形式体现出来,该计算机软件产品存储在可读取的存储介质中,如计算机的软盘,硬盘或光盘等,包括若干指令用以使得一台计算机设备(可以是个人计算机, 服务器,或者网络设备等)执行本发明各个实施例所述的方法。以上所述,仅为本发明的具体实施方式
,但本发明的保护范围并不局限于此,任何熟悉本技术领域的技术人员在本发明揭露的技术范围内,可轻易想到变化或替换,都应涵盖在本发明的保护范围之内。因此,本发明的保护范围应以所述权利要求的保护范围为准。
权利要求
1.一种信息提醒的方法,其特征在于,包括接收终端设备发送的状态信息,并根据所述状态信息携带的用户标识将所述状态信息保存到与所述用户标识对应的状态信息集合中;在需要发送提醒信息时,根据所述提醒信息携带的用户标识获取与所述用户标识对应的状态信息集合,所述状态信息集合包括同一个用户标识对应的多个终端设备的状态信息;根据所述状态信息集合选取目的终端设备,将所述提醒信息发送给所述目的终端设备。
2.根据权利要求1所述的信息提醒的方法,所述根据所述状态信息集合选取目的终端设备,将所述提醒信息发送给所述目的终端设备包括根据所述状态信息集合,生成分别对应于所述多个终端设备的优先级值; 根据所述对应于所述多个终端设备的优先级值,选取目的终端设备,所述目的用户终端为优先级值最大的用户终端;将所述提醒信息发送给所述目的终端设备。
3.根据权利要求1所述的信息提醒的方法,其特征在于,所述状态信息包括重力传感器数据、终端设备最近使用时间以及终端设备预设置的优先级。
4.根据权利要求2所述的信息提醒的方法,其特征在于,所述根据所述状态信息集合, 生成分别对应于所述多个终端设备的优先级值包括根据所述多个终端设备的状态信息集合,生成分别对应于所述多个终端设备的终端设备访问次数;根据所述状态信息及所述终端设备访问次数,生成分别对应于所述多个终端设备的优先级值。
5.一种信息提醒的装置,其特征在于,包括接收保存模块,用于接收终端设备发送的状态信息,并根据所述状态信息携带的用户标识将所述状态信息保存到与所述用户标识对应的状态信息集合中;获取模块,用于在需要发送提醒信息时,根据所述提醒信息携带的用户标识获取与所述用户标识对应的所述接收保存模块保存的状态信息集合,所述状态信息集合包括同一个用户标识对应的多个终端设备的状态信息;选取发送模块,用于根据所述获取模块获取的所述状态信息集合选取目的终端设备, 将所述提醒信息发送给所述目的终端设备。
6.根据权利要求5所述的信息提醒的装置,其特征在于,所述选取发送模块包括生成单元,用于根据所述状态信息集合,生成分别对应于所述多个终端设备的优先级值;选取单元,用于根据所述生成单元生成的所述对应于所述多个终端设备的优先级值, 选取目的终端设备,所述目的用户终端为优先级值最大的用户终端;发送单元,用于将所述提醒信息发送给所述选取单元选取的所述目的终端设备。
7.根据权利要求5所述的信息提醒的装置,其特征在于,所述状态信息包括重力传感器数据、终端设备最近使用时间以及终端设备预设置的优先级。
8.根据权利要求6所述的信息提醒的装置,其特征在于,生成单元包括第一生成子单元,用于根据所述多个终端设备的状态信息集合,生成分别对应于所述多个终端设备的终端设备访问次数;第二生成子单元,用于根据所述状态信息及所述终端设备访问次数,生成分别对应于所述多个终端设备的优先级值。
9. 一种信息提醒的系统,其特征在于,包括终端状态检测模块,用于接收终端设备发送的状态信息,并根据所述状态信息携带的用户标识将所述状态信息保存到与所述用户标识对应的状态信息集合中;云端服务模块,用于在需要发送提醒信息时,根据所述提醒信息携带的用户标识获取与所述用户标识对应的状态信息集合,所述状态信息集合包括同一个用户标识对应的多个终端设备的状态信息,根据所述状态信息集合选取目的终端设备;选择设备发送信息模块,用于将所述提醒信息发送给所述目的终端设备。
全文摘要
本发明公开了一种信息提醒的方法、装置及系统,涉及通讯技术领域,实现了拥有多个终端设备的用户,在设置信息提醒后能够及时准确地接收到提醒信息。本发明包括接收终端设备发送的状态信息,并根据所述状态信息携带的用户标识将所述状态信息保存到与所述用户标识对应的状态信息集合中;在需要发送提醒信息时,根据所述提醒信息携带的用户标识获取与所述用户标识对应的状态信息集合,所述状态信息集合包括同一个用户标识对应的多个终端设备的状态信息;根据所述状态信息集合选取目的终端设备,将所述提醒信息发送给所述目的终端设备。本发明实施例主要用于向用户发送提醒信息的过程中。
文档编号H04L12/58GK102404397SQ20111036196
公开日2012年4月4日 申请日期2011年11月15日 优先权日2011年11月15日
发明者何平, 林华坚 申请人:宇龙计算机通信科技(深圳)有限公司
网友询问留言 已有0条留言
  • 还没有人留言评论。精彩留言会获得点赞!
1